scsi: lpfc: fix: Coverity: lpfc_cmpl_els_rsp(): Null pointer dereferences

Coverity reported the following:

*** CID 101747:  Null pointer dereferences  (FORWARD_NULL)
/drivers/scsi/lpfc/lpfc_els.c: 4439 in lpfc_cmpl_els_rsp()
4433      kfree(mp);
4434      }
4435      mempool_free(mbox, phba->mbox_mem_pool);
4436      }
4437     out:
4438      if (ndlp && NLP_CHK_NODE_ACT(ndlp)) {
vvv     CID 101747:  Null pointer dereferences  (FORWARD_NULL)
vvv     Dereferencing null pointer "shost".
4439      spin_lock_irq(shost->host_lock);
4440      ndlp->nlp_flag &= ~(NLP_ACC_REGLOGIN | NLP_RM_DFLT_RPI);
4441      spin_unlock_irq(shost->host_lock);
4442
4443      /* If the node is not being used by another discovery thread,
4444       * and we are sending a reject, we are done with it.

Fix by adding a check for non-null shost in line 4438.
The scenario when shost is set to null is when ndlp is null.
As such, the ndlp check present was sufficient. But better safe
than sorry so add the shost check.
